BORNO, Nigeria (Mandy News) — Nigeria’s Air Force has confirmed it lost contact with one of its light attack jets, which disappeared from radar screens Wednesday, March 31, 2021, during a fight with Boko Haram.
The Nigerian Air Force (NAF) Director of Public Relations and Information, Air Commodore Edward Gabkwet reported that an Alpha-Jet took off on Wednesday on an interdiction mission in support of ground troops, but it disappeared from the radar screen at 5:08 p.m. The aircraft disappeared in Born, a state in north-eastern Nigeria while going to support the ground fighters.
What Nigerian Air Force said about the missing Alpha-Jet.
“Details of the whereabouts of the aircraft or likely cause of contact loss are still sketchy but will be relayed to the general public as soon as they become clear. Meanwhile, search and rescue efforts are ongoing.”
